Genesee Valley Watershed Improvement Project
Description
The Genesee Valley Watershed Improvement Project is a collaborative project aimed at reducing the risk of high-severity wildfire as well as taking steps toward restoring watershed and forest health through hand-thinning, hand piling, pile burning and broadcast burning of approx 839 acres of forested National Forest and adjacent private land. The purpose of the project is to implement hand thinning and a prescribed burn to reduce fuel loading within the project area to the point that fuels would burn at low to moderate severity during future wildfires. This reduction of fuel loads would help to reduce the threat of future wildfires from burning at high severity therefore potentially residents adjacent to the project area, protecting the watershed from degradation, and improving habitat values including late seral forest.
